The Subfloor Water Extraction Process: What to Expect

Our team’s process for Subfloor Water Extraction is designed to reduce disruption and get your home back to normal as quickly as possible. We’ll start by assessing the damage to find out the best course of action. From there, we’ll use our specialized equipment to extract water from your subfloor, followed by thorough drying and dehumidification to prevent mold growth.

Step 1: Assessment and Planning

We’ll assess the extent of the damage, identifying the source of the water and the affected areas. This step is crucial in determining the best extraction and drying strategy. Our team will work with you to develop a customized plan to get your home back in shape.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Using our specialized equipment, we’ll extract water from your subfloor, working to remove as much moisture as possible. This process can take several hours depending on the severity of the damage. Our team will work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your home back to normal.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

After water extraction, we’ll use specialized drying equipment to remove excess moisture from the affected areas. This step is critical in preventing mold growth and ensuring your home remains safe and healthy. We’ll work with you to monitor progress and adjust our strategy as needed.

Step 4: Final Inspection and Sanitizing

Once the drying process is complete, we’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ure your home is safe and secure. We’ll also sanitize the affected areas to prevent future mold growth and ensure your home remains healthy and clean.

Warning Signs You Need Subfloor Water Extraction

Catching these signs early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ent bigger problems down the line. Don’t ignore these warning signs, act fast to prevent further damage.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ice persistent musty odors in your home, it may be a sign of hidden water damage. This can lead to mold growth and health issues, so it’s essential to address the problem quickly.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age, especially if it’s accompanied by musty odors or discoloration. Don’t delay call a pro to assess the damage and develop a plan to fix it.

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ls

Water stains on ceilings or walls can be a sign of a larger issue, such as a roof leak or plumbing problem. Address the problem qu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s.

Unexplained Dampness or Condensation

Unexplained dampness or condensation in your home can be a sign of hidden water damage. Don’t ignore this issue, act fast to prevent further damage and health risks.

Water Damage in Unseen Areas

Water damage can occur in unseen areas, such as behind walls or under flooring. Don’t assume everything is fine, call a pro to assess the damage and develop a plan to fix it.

Visible Signs of Water Damage

Visible signs of water damage, such as water spots or mineral deposits, can be a sign of a larger issue. Don’t delay call a pro to assess the damage and develop a plan to fix it.

Subfloor Water Extraction vs. DIY: When to Call a Pro

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water spill (less than 1 gallon) Yes No You can likely handle a small spill on your own with a wet/dry vacuum.
Water damage in a single room No Yes Water damage in a single room can quickly spread to adjacent areas, making it difficult to contain without professional help.
Water damage in multiple rooms or areas No Yes Water damage in multiple rooms or areas needs specialized equipment and expertise to contain and dry effectively.
Hidden water damage (behind walls or under flooring) No Yes Hidden water damage can be difficult to detect and needs specialized equipment and expertise to locate and fix.
Water damage in a home with a complex layout or multiple levels No Yes Water damage in a complex home needs specialized equipment and expertise to navigate and contain effectively.
Water damage in a home with sensitive or high-value items (e.g. Electronics, artwork) No Yes Water damage in a home with sensitive or high-value items needs specialized care and handling to prevent damage or loss.

Subfloor Water Extraction Cost in Marysville, WA

The cost of Subfloor Water Extraction in Marysville, WA will v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Expect to pay between $500 and $2,500 for a standard extraction and drying job. But, prices can range from $1,000 to $5,000 or more for more extensive damage or complex situations.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Standard Extraction and Drying $500-$2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ions
Extended Drying and Dehumidification $1,000-$3,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ions
Water Damage Assessment and Inspection $200-$500 Severity of damage, size of affected area
Specialized Equipment Rental (e.g. Wet/dry vacuum) $100-$500 Severity of damage, size of affected area
Emergency Response and Overnight Monitoring $500-$1,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ions
More Labor and Materials (e.g. Drywall repair) $500-$2,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ions

Common Questions About Subfloor Water Extraction

What causes subfloor water damage?

Subfloor water damage is often caused by plumbing leaks, roof leaks, or flooding. Identifying the source of the problem is crucial to preventing further damage and costly repairs.

How long does subfloor water extraction take?

The length of time required for subfloor water extraction will depend on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Typically extraction and drying can take 3-5 days, but this may vary depending on the situation.

Can I do subfloor water extraction myself?

While it’s possible to extract water from a small area, it’s not recommended to try subfloor water extraction yourself, especially if the damage is extensive or hidden. Call a pro to ensure the job is done right and safely.

How much does subfloor water extraction cost?

The cost of subfloor water extraction will depend on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Expect to pay between $500 and $2,500 for a standard extraction and drying job.

What happens if I don’t address subfloor water damage?

If you don’t address subfloor water damage, it can lead to costly repairs and health risks. Water damage can seep into your home’s foundation, causing structural issues and mold growth. Don’t wait act fast to prevent further damage.
